Capital Lease
A lease classified as a financial transaction, where the lessee essentially buys an asset and borrows the money through a lease to pay for it, leading to asset and liability recognition in the balance sheet.
Operating Lease
A leasing agreement that allows for the use of an asset but does not convey rights of ownership to the lessee.
Accounts Payable
The amount of money owed by a company to its suppliers or creditors for goods or services received.
Operating Activities
Transactions and events that are directly related to the primary operations of the company, such as sales and service delivery.
